Position Summary:

The Manager, Global Marketing Batteries, is a brand manager and steward responsible for globally supporting and driving the 4Ps (product, packaging, pricing and placement), including helping to develop overall Product Strategies for the Batteries Portfolio, leading and assisting product innovation via the Marketing Cycle Plan, and assisting on sourcing, claims, packaging and other elements to achieve profit, sales, brand and share goals. 

Responsibilities:
  • Help in development and deployment of product innovation in the Marketing Cycle plan for Batteries Portfolio
  • Participate in setting the overall product strategy aligned with the brand strategy based on company, consumer, competitive, and marketplace dynamics
  • Assist in development and execution of the 3-year innovation product cycle plan serving as a liaison to R&D to ensure alignment, technical capabilities, consumer claims development, substantiation, etc,.
  • Lead product initiatives from initial scoping phase through the entire Stage Gate process until final implementation and delivery.  Includes cross-functional team leadership, project management, financial reviews, key milestones and critical issues identification, leadership presentations and reviews, etc.
  • Brand marketing skills in leading and driving collaboration to deliver annual global marketing plans that support product initiatives / key projects to include consumer rationale, supporting area assets, pricing strategies, marketing guidelines, trade selling stories, and more as outlined in the asset grid
  • Partner with Consumer Insights team to understand consumer needs and perceptions as related to the sub-segment, trends, claims, product ideas, etc to inform Marketing plans.
  • Develop and deliver engaging presentations as part of deployment process
  • Partner closely with Legal and R&D to ensure sourcing/performance/claims/messaging are accurate
  • Demonstrate an on-going understanding of battery business via analysis through key tools. Understand competitive intelligence and changing marketplace dynamics for input into global strategies.
  • Serve as a key knowledge expert and resource for batteries and associated projects and respond with a sense of urgency to priority internal and external ‘customer’ requests. Seek to build knowledge and internal relationships to assist in responsiveness.
  • Facilitate communication between Global and Activation by developing strong relationships with Activation Colleagues through regular contact, securing appropriate feedback on cycle plans, asset grid, claims, visibility etc.
  • Track competitive updates for respective sub-segment (packs/claims/performance/pricing) in key markets and provide updates to Category Batteries Team
